Monopod Conversion

Each  leg  can  be  unscrewed  from  the  tripod 

basis  and  converted  (using  the  supplied  QP 

MONO plate) to a single monopod.

Interchangeable Feet

All legs are equipped with rubber feet 

at its ends and can be replaced by stain-

less steel spikes (included in the scope 

of delivery).

Accessory Ports

The  tripod  basis  has,  apart  from  the 

leg  connections,  two  side-on  coun-

tersunk 1/4“ drilled holes (1) to attach 

additional accessories with 1/4“ thread 

screw such as the two Mini Legs (in-

cluded in scope of delivery) or flexible 

gooseneck  arms  in  order  to  mount 

flash lights, microphones or reflectors.

Detent Angle Stops

For near-ground operation the tripod 

basis  is  equipped  with  detent  angle 

stops for the purpose of spreading the 

legs in predefined angles of 23°, 45°, 

65° and 87°. An additional angle stop 

at 155° enables to support the tripod 

against a wall, for example in narrow 

places  like  interiors.  Furthermore  the 

tripod is equipped with an angle stop 

for  transport  in  standard  position,  in 

order to carry the tripod comfortably 

grabbing only one leg.

To achieve as low as possible packing 

size the legs can be turned 180° and 

grouped  around  the  center  column 

with mounted tripod head.

Technical Data TRIOPRO C3930 and TRIOPRO C3940

•  3- respectively 4 section carbon fiber legs, 8-layered

•  Leg extension length: 60.5-161 cm (23.8-63.3 in.) respectively 50-161 cm (19.7-63.3 in.)

•  Maximum working height: 154 cm (60.6 in.)

•  Minimum working height: approximately. 5.5 cm (2.1 in.)

•  Folded length (basis with legs, normal): 69 cm (27 in.) respectively  57 cm (22 in.)

•  Max. load: 65 kg (143 lbs)

•  Upper stud screw : 3/8“

•  Lateral accessory ports: 2 countersunk 1/4“ drilled holes

•  Leg angle stops: 23°, 45°, 65°, 87°, 155° and 180°

•  Legs can be turned 180° for transport

•  Leg diameter (mm): 39; 35.5; 31.5; 27.5  (1.5, 1.4, 1.2, 1.1 in.)

•  Total weight 3205 g (7.066 lbs) respectively 3175 g (6.999 lbs)

•  Rubber feet, which can be replaced by stainless steel spikes (included)

•  Two interchangeable Mini Legs for the accessory ports, the Multi-Tool and a carrying   

    bag are included in the delivery

Technical Data geared center column TRIO CC-PRO75

•  Provides an additional 48 cm (18.9 in.) of height adjustment

•  Weight: 925 g (2.04 lb.)

•  Camera Connection: 3/8“ and 1/4“ on both sides
